Loved Ones Unearth Disturbing News of Abuse at Kirrawee Nursing Home through Email

A Sydney family was devastated when they received an email informing them that their loved one had been brutally attacked in a nursing home. Joan Hobbs, 89, was beaten to death by another dementia patient at the IRT Thomas Holt Aged Care Centre. The family believes that the attack could have been prevented if the facility had been adequately staffed. They were only notified of the attack hours later through an email, which described the injuries sustained by their mother. Joan passed away five days after the email was sent. Advocates are now calling for better protection of aged care residents. The Minister of Aged Care stated that 24/7 nursing has been mandated in all residential facilities. Joan’s daughter expressed her shock and sadness over her mother’s death and the severe injuries she suffered. The family does not blame the attacker or the staff, but rather the system that failed their mother. They are demanding better staffing levels to prevent such tragedies from occurring again. The incident has been reported to the Aged Care Quality and Safety Commission, and a police investigation is underway.
